    How To Utilize Hospital Security Cameras To Enhance Security

    In a world where safety has grown to become a major concern, the role of security cameras, especially in sensitive places such as hospitals, cannot be underestimated. Ensuring the well-being of patients, staff, and visitors is paramount in maintaining a conducive environment for care and recovery. Below, we delve into techniques to use hospital security cameras for optimized security.

    Understanding the Importance of Hospital Security Cameras

    Security cameras serve as a great deterrent to prevent unwanted activities. They provide video proof of events that occur in real-time, protecting the hospital from potential liabilities. This can prove invaluable when dealing with legal disputes.

    In a hospital setting, they monitor sensitive areas such as delivery rooms and pharmacies, ensuring the safety of newborns and preventing unauthorized access to medications. They also help monitor patient flow and visitor activity, ensuring proper management.

    Besides crime prevention, cameras play a crucial role in ensuring adherence to health protocols. They can help monitor cleaning routines, proper handwashing, or the use of masks and gloves to prevent infections.

    Furthermore, data captured by cameras can be used to improve hospital operations. For example, observations of patient movement and staff interaction can be used to streamline work processes and improve patient care.

    Optimal Placement of Security Cameras in Hospitals

    Proper positioning of hospital security cameras is pivotal for maximizing their usefulness. The cameras must cover all entrance and exit points, including emergency exits. The monitors should be placed securely where the hospital security team can observe the footage.

    Cameras should also be installed in corridors leading to vital hospital areas, such as operating rooms, pharmacies, and intensive care units. Parking lots and other outdoor locations should also be well covered, as they are potential hotspots for criminal activities.

    Camera coverage should not infringe on patient privacy. Areas like washrooms and patient rooms should ideally be excluded, except under special circumstances. Positioning cameras in such a way that does not capture patients in a compromising position is ethically and legally important.

    Signage indicating video security serves as a deterrent to potential wrongdoers and also gives an assurance of safety to hospital users.

    Leveraging Technology for Enhanced Hospital Security

    With advancements in technology, today’s cameras go beyond mere recording of footage. They can now provide real-time alerts for suspicious activities such as unauthorized entry or extended loitering, allowing swift response by security personnel.

    Integration with other security systems, such as alarm systems, access control systems, and patient tracking systems, can create a comprehensive security solution. For instance, analytics from video footage can be used to improve patient flow and optimize staffing levels.

    Moreover, remote monitoring and mobile access to security footage can empower the security team to take immediate action, even when they are away from the security control room. Facial recognition technology can also assist with identifying known perpetrators or potentially violent individuals.

    As technology evolves, so do cyber threats. Ensuring cyber-secure cameras is vital to prevent potential data breaches and maintain the integrity of the security system.

    Best Practices in Maintaining and Monitoring Hospital Security Cameras

    Maintenance of security camera systems is crucial in ensuring their effective operation. Regular checks should be undertaken to verify that cameras are working properly and provide clear images. Dusting and cleaning of lenses are essential and should be conducted regularly.

    Moreover, video footage should be reviewed periodically to assess the system’s performance. Checking for blind spots and reassessing the camera placement could help in enhancing overall security.

    The training of security personnel in proper security techniques is vital. They should be skilled at recognizing suspicious activities and responding to alerts promptly and appropriately.

    In addition, strict policies should be in place for accessing security footage to prevent undue invasion of privacy. Regular audits should be conducted to keep track of who accesses the system and when.

    The placement, selection, technology, and maintenance of security cameras play integral roles in ensuring the effectiveness of the hospital security system. By understanding these aspects, hospitals can elevate security and provide a safer environment for all.
